The Stresses Of The Cold War, The Social Unrest In The Baby Boom Generation.
Figuring out the baby boom generation probably should start with the definition of the U.S. Department of the Annual official population poll. They categorize an individual as a baby boomer if they were born in the time period from 1946 until 1964. Others have proposed a bit different time frames for the United States, and the time period is different for other countries as the increase in births occurred sooner or later by a few years.
The baby boom was nicknamed by a writer and journalist named Landon Jones. As a result, the later born half of the age group is usually also known as Generation Jones in his honor. A well known member of Generation Jones is the current President of the United State, Barack Obama, who was born in 1961. Similarly, a notable member of the sooner half of the generation was the last Leader, George W. Bush.
While the first of the baby boom generation was born into a time frame of serenity and prosperity right after the second World War, there was considerable turmoil ahead. War broke out in Korea in the early 1950's and some boomers lost a parent in that turmoil. Through the entire 50's and into the 60's the Cold War raged and there was a substantial environment of stress and also fear of nuclear annihilation.
Social unrest was also part and parcel of the 50's and 60's. The civil rights movement sought voting and other rights for African-Americans and quite often led to physical violence. There were lynchings and murders, violent manifestations and assassinations such as that of Martin Luther King Jr. Also the numerous peaceful actions and demonstrations caused uneasiness since they demanded radical alterations to the status quo.
Environmentalism and also the movement for women's rights also triggered some turmoil, although this was hardly ever violent. The advent of the Vietnam War and the army draft that accompanied it triggered unprecedented anti-war activism and opposition. Public opinion relating to this battle was largely shaped by seeing it daily on television, something that had never been possible before.
Via a time of lightning fast technological change, the baby boom generation managed to get substantial wealth and purchasing potential. Over 77 million powerful, the baby boom generation controls over half of the spending power in the USA. As this largest of American generations gets to retirement age, it remains to be observed what the financial changes of retirement means to the economic system.
